Pamela's obituary

Pamela Sue Ponds, 69, reunited with loved ones in heaven on February 11, 2025, after a battle with dementia.

Pam’s smile and sense of humor left a lasting impression on everyone she encountered. She attended Welch Creek Baptist Church faithfully and was a medical transcriptionist at Walterboro Family Practice for decades. Some of her favorite pastimes were sharing laughter and good food (made by someone else) with family and friends, going to church, watching Gamecocks sports, assembling massive jigsaw puzzles, cutting the grass, and fishing. She will be forever remembered with love as a wonderful mother, proud Grammie, loyal friend, faithful Christian, enthusiastic USC fan, and determined armadillo hunter.

Pam was preceded in death by her parents Lyonell and Dorothy Griffin; sister Tina Berry; granddaughter Cacey Beyer; and menace Yorkie Harley. She is survived by her children Matthew Ponds and Ashley Beyer (Randall); grandchildren Riley and Cara Beyer; nephews Curtis Berry (Ashley, Hudson, Miles), Travis Berry (Jennifer, Keeten), and Coby Berry (Taylor, Hadley); brother-in-law David Berry; and brother David Griffin. She also deeply loved her former in-laws Miriam and Joe Ponds, the extended Ponds family, and her Griffin relatives.

Pam's Celebration of Life will be held at Welch Creek Baptist Church in Walterboro, South Carolina, on Saturday, July 26, 2025, at 11 a.m. with lunch immediately following the service. This is a celebration, not a funeral, so there is no need for suits, long sleeves, black clothes, or tissues. Join us in honoring her vibrant personality by wearing colorful clothes and bringing your smile, laughter, and fondest memories.

In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to the Lewy Body Dementia Association (lbda.org/donate) or the University of South Carolina (donate.sc.edu)
